A young Palestinian died on Monday as a result of being wounded by Israeli occupation bullets in Tulkarm, northern occupied West Bank. According to Palestine News and Information Agency (WAFA), local sources said that the 35-year-old man, who was identified as Ammar Abdallah Oufi, was seriously injured by occupation bullets earlier Monday during the ongoing Israeli military offensive against the Tulkarem camp, while he was present near his house in the nearby Danaba neighborhood. He was transferred to the hospital in critical condition, where he was declared dead later. Large forces from the occupation army, estimated at around 50 military vehicles, accompanied by four heavy bulldozers, stormed the city of Tulkarm at Monday dawn from its western and southern axes and roamed its streets and neighborhoods before heading to the Tulkarm camp, where the occupation forces have continued their aggression against the city of Tulkarm and its camp for more than 20 hours.
